WebSolution. Argon is a example of isobars which have molecular weight 40 and 18 is its atomic weight so its neutron will be 22. Argon has numerous isotopes, of which the most abundant by far is Argon 40; that is 18 protons and 22 neutrons. (18+22=40). So not all argon atoms have 22 neutrons, but most of them do in the natural world.
